Output 8f35a6fd09a320579cb7090d28221c2eaabf527b1abb810fbb1e3eccac1490c8:2

value
73974396
script pubkey
OP_0 OP_PUSHBYTES_20 bbaaec08c1400147f99376e18ef27dcb868c34c6
address
bc1qhw4wczxpgqq507vnwmscaunaewrgcdxxd0cygs
transaction
8f35a6fd09a320579cb7090d28221c2eaabf527b1abb810fbb1e3eccac1490c8
confirmations
123476
spent
true